TNT will host Tuesday’s matchup between the Portland Trail Blazers and Denver Nuggets, with tip-off set for 10:00 p.m. ET. The game will take place at the Ball Arena in Denver, Colorado. If you aren’t around a TV to check out this primetime NBA matchup, you can stream the game on Watch TNT or via their mobile app. But keep in mind that you need a cable-login subscription.

If you don’t have a cable login to access TNT for live stream, you can get a free trial from YouTube TV, Hulu with Live TV, AT&T TV Now, FuboTV, or Sling TV to stream the game.

The Trail Blazers are coming into this matchup off on a two-game losing streak after falling 132-100 to the Phoenix Suns on Monday night. Despite the loss, Portland still has a record of 7-3 in their last 10 games and are 9-7 against other teams from the west.

The Nuggets are coming off a 123-115 loss to the Atlanta Hawks on Sunday. They have now lost three out of their last five games and are 6-4 in their last 10. PJ Dozier (hamstring), Gary Harris (thigh), JaMychal Green (shoulder), and Paul Millsap (knee) have all been ruled out for Tuesday night’s contest.
